preventDefault在React中怎么用
导读:在React中,可以通过在事件处理函数中调用event.preventDefault( 方法来阻止默认的事件行为。例如,如果需要阻止表单的默认提交行为,可以在表单的onSubmit事件处理函数中调用event.preventDefault(...
在React中,可以通过在事件处理函数中调用event.preventDefault()
方法来阻止默认的事件行为。例如,如果需要阻止表单的默认提交行为,可以在表单的onSubmit
事件处理函数中调用event.preventDefault()
方法。
import React from 'react';
class MyForm extends React.Component {
handleSubmit = (event) =>
{
event.preventDefault();
// 阻止表单默认提交行为
// 其他处理逻辑
}
;
render() {
return (
<
form onSubmit={
this.handleSubmit}
>
<
input type="text" />
<
button type="submit">
Submit<
/button>
<
/form>
);
}
}
export default MyForm;
在上面的例子中,当用户点击提交按钮时,handleSubmit
方法会被调用,并且event.preventDefault()
方法会阻止表单的默认提交行为,从而实现了阻止表单提交的效果。
声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!
若转载请注明出处: preventDefault在React中怎么用
本文地址: https://pptw.com/jishu/684507.html